Race Report: Perfect 10

This past Sunday I raced in the Perfect 10 - where you have a choice of 10 miles and 10K. I had a 6 mile run scheduled for the weekend long run so of course that made the 10K 'perfect' for me! Team Rabbit rapped about the race on Monday, but I wanted to write my own report. 

Earlier in the week I'd had a tempo run scheduled. When it came down to the workout I was just not feeling it! I actually had cut the workout short. I did little the next two days and had decided on race day I would make up the tempo run. The plan was to take the first two miles at an easy pace, then up the tempo for miles three and four, and maybe five. Then back off for the final mile point two.

The 10-miler and 10K all started together. The course was a nice rolling loop! As planned I took the first two miles easy and got to run with SRab. We hit the 2-mile mark and she was going to tone it down while I was going to amp it up. And I did! 

My third mile was right about on target, even with a hill / climb thrown in. However, the fourth mile was above the target pace as there was another longer climb. I decided I was ready to back off the pace a bit, but not slow down to my warm-up pace. And believe it or not, there was enough of a decline that my fifth mile was faster than my fourth! I kept at the pace and caught up with RBud just past mile 5. She and I traded off in the last mile and then at the end I worked on my finish kick. Thankfully when I got to the track it was good to see that I only had to run about a quarter of the way around, as opposed to three quarters, like some of the races that finish there. Just as I was nearing the finish line I was passed by a speedy gal who was finishing the 10-miler! Wow! This is nutty but I heard her tell someone right after we crossed that she had puked! I can only imagine how much faster she would have been had she NOT puked!
